Favorite Cranberry Nut Bars
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 40 Minutes
Servings: 24
Each fall when cranberries are harvested, I buy many bags and put them in the freezer. That way I can enjoy these delicious berries all year long. This dessert is a favorite at potluck suppers.
Ingredients:
2 eggs
1 cup sugar
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up butter, melted
1-1/2 cups king arthur unbleached all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
2 cups fresh or frozen cranberries
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
Directions:
1. In a bowl, beat eggs, sugar, extracts and salt. Add butter. Combine flour and baking powder; gradually add to the sugar mixture and mix well. Fold in cranberries and nuts. Transfer to a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 30-35 minutes or until golden brown. Cool on a wire rack. Cut into bars. Yield: 2 dozen.
